HYBE has discovered the source of BTS's flight ticket leak... After 2 years of tracking
A foreign airline employee, A, who made money by obtaining flight information for famous celebrities such as "BTS," has been charged by the police, and this is the first time that the route of the information leak has been revealed.
Last month, an airline employee named Mr. A was charged by the police with violating the Information and Communications Network Act after he researched and sold the flight information of famous celebrities.
While operators of social media accounts have been referred to prosecutors in the past, this is the first time that the route through which such information was leaked has been uncovered.
On the 4th, according to Yonhap News, BTS' management company HYBE responded to the issue of personal information leaks on flights.
In order to investigate the leaks, the 2023 Task Force (TF) was formed and has been working with the police to continue to track down the leaks of aviation information.
However, flight information was traded secretly through open chat rooms and direct mail, and the location of the information leaking source was unclear, making it difficult to arrest the suspects.
The routes through which the information on the tickets was leaked were also numerous and difficult to track. In response, HYBE has been constantly monitoring SNS sellers for two years and has collected evidence to identify the operators (sales agents).
The documents were secured, opening the door to a police investigation. In June of last year, HYBE said, "We have inquired about the seating information of our artists several times and boarded the same planes."
Using this information, people have been caught stalking artists, continuously approaching them and even trying to contact them.
"We are seeing frequent instances of excessive behavior, such as passengers arbitrarily changing in-flight meals or canceling flight reservations, disrupting their schedules," he said.
HYBE formed a separate task force to deal with the situation and successfully arrested the suspect.
"We will take a zero-tolerance approach to the criminal act of commercializing and trading these drugs, and we will hold those responsible to account and take strict action without any compromise or leniency," he said.
On the other hand, Mr. A has been posting information about the flight boarding of dozens of popular celebrities, including "BTS," from 2023 to last year as a sasaeng (stalker fan).
It has been discovered that the higher the price paid for air ticket information, the more specific the schedule becomes.
